how can you find the area of a square and rectangle

The area of a square can be found by knowing the length of one side. Once you know the length of one side, you plug it into this formula:

Area of a square = side × side = side²

The area of a rectangle can be found by knowing the length and width of the rectangle. Once you know that, you plug it into this formula:

Area of a rectangle = length × width
